If you enjoy fresh salads, just remember that the label is before processing! This tastes much better if you allow time for the veggies to re-hydrate and add an 1/8 cup of extra warm water when the container is removed from the microwave. I added onion flakes and red pepper flakes (standard for me) . . . no salt substitute needed. It's good cold, hot or room temperature. The first one was an experiment . . . add a dash of cider vinegar or lime for an added touch. The top makes it convenient to store in the fridge to allow time for the flavor to develop. Simple to use the lid and allow about 15 minutes (at least) for best flavor. Dr. McDougall's is a favorite brand and I've come to know what to expect . . . this one is an 'OK' if you follow the directions and much better if you allow that extra time for the fresh flavor to develop. Worth trying if you enjoy black beans and quinoa. For a low sodium diet, this is really good!

It's a quick and nutritious snack or light lunch. I add a lot more water than recommended (up to the upper blue line on the label) and also add hot sauce. Next time, I might bring some greens to go with it, so it actually feels like a salad.

I have tried it both ways...with hot water and in a microwave. Taste is good for an instant. Texture is a little too thick using the amount of water directed. I will add more the next time and expect that to improve the consistency.
